Odor and irritation play a prominent role in the quality of air when environmental tobacco smoke is present within a building. This book offers guidance to HVAC designers so they can provide better, more efficient units for ventilation, thus creating optimized air quality, comfort, and energy use.

This design guide focuses primarily on the design structure of units and less on the requirements of codes and guidelines. With the proper guidance, HVAC designers will be able to produce a highly efficient system that will assure companies and clients they are receiving quality ventilation flow.

This guide can be used as an introduction to environmental tobacco smoke (ETS), as a refresher to those within the HVAC industry, a tool to stimulate more discussion and research, as well as a reference for architects and building owners who already have experience with ETS concerns.
